Eligibility criteria

Reproduced verbatim from the official record. Eligibility is decided by the study team, never by this page.

Inclusion Criteria:

1. Able to understand and provide written informed consent, and comply with the requirements specified in the protocol.
2. Life expectancy ≥ 3 months.
3. Must provide tumor tissue specimens for GPC3 testing.
4. Histologically/cytologically confirmed h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C), Barcelona Clinic Liver Cancer (BCLC) Stage C or Stage B not amenable to curative surgery and/or locoregional therapy.
5. At least one measurable lesion per Response Evaluation Criteria in Solid Tumors version 1.1 (RECIST v1.1) and modified RECIST (mRECIST).
6. No prior systemic antineoplastic therapy for unresectable HCC before first dose administration.
7.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) performance status of 0 or 1, with no deterioration within 2 weeks prior to first study drug administration.
8. Adequate organ function as specified.
9. Negative serum pregnancy test within 7 days prior to first dose (women of childbearing potential). Pregnant or lactating women are not eligible for this study.
10. Women of childbearing potential and male patients must agree to use adequate contraception during MRG006A treatment and for 180 days after the last infusion.

Exclusion Criteria:

1. Prior histologically/cytologically confirmed diagnosis of hepatocellular carcinoma with fibrolamellar, sarcomatoid, cholangiocarcinoma, or other components.
2. History of hepatic failure or hepatic encephalopathy, or history of liver transplantation.
3. Pleural effusion, ascites, or pelvic effusion, or clinically significant pericardial effusion.
4. Acute or chronic active hepatitis B or hepatitis C infection.
5. Central nervous system metastases.
6. Prior locoregional therapy for hepatocellular carcinoma within 4 weeks before first dose administration.
7. Receipt of live attenuated vaccines within 4 weeks before first dose or planned administration during the study period.
8. Major surgical procedure within 4 weeks before first dose, or the presence of unhealed wounds, ulcers, or bone fractures.
9. Uncontrolled or poorly controlled medical conditions.
10. Toxicities from prior therapy that have not resolved to Grade 0 or 1 before first dose of study treatment.
11. Severe cardiac insufficiency or cerebrovascular events within 6 months prior, or occurrence of pulmonary embolism, deep vein thrombosis, gastrointestinal perforation and/or fistula, or intestinal obstruction.
12. Patients with double or multiple primary malignancies.
13. Hypersensitivity to any component or excipient of the investigational product.
14. Active or poorly controlled severe infection.
15. Any severe and/or uncontrolled systemic disease that, in the opinion of the investigator and sponsor, renders the patient unsuitable for participation in this study.
